Instructions to Assessors

Required Skills and Knowledge

Evidence required to demonstrate competence in this unit must be relevant to and satisfy all of the requirements of the elements, performance criteria and range of conditions on at least two separate occasions and include:

applying relevant work health and safety (WHS)/occupational health and safety (OHS) requirements, including

using risk control measures

dealing with unplanned events in accordance with problem-solving techniques and workplace procedures

determining material properties

documenting and reporting results of the material analysis

documenting instruction for implementing any actions resulting from the analysis

documenting justification of actions to be implemented

forming strategies for analysing machine performance

obtaining machine characteristics, specifications and performance requirements appropriate to each situation

preparing to analyse materials

testing results of the analysis.

Evidence required to demonstrate competence in this unit must be relevant to and satisfy all of the requirements of the elements, performance criteria and range of conditions and include knowledge of:

problem-solving techniques

relevant analysis methods

relevant implementation strategies

relevant industry standards

relevant machine characteristics, specifications and performance requirements

relevant manufacturer specifications and operating instructions

relevant materials

relevant job safety assessments or risk mitigation processes

relevant WHS/OHS legislated requirements

relevant workplace documentation

relevant workplace quality, instructions, policies and procedures.
